Abstract

<P>PROBLEM TO BE SOLVED: To provide a cap structure of a container whose seal band left on the mouth part of a container main body is not dropped in using, and is easily removed in separating the main body and the cap as to the cap structure of a container which is opened by separating the seal band attached to the cap main body. <P>SOLUTION: This cap of a container comprises a cap main body (10) screwed on the mouth part (2) of a container main body (3), and an annular seal band (12) attached to the bottom end of the cap main body through a fragile part (11). The seal band (12) is protrusively provided with a plurality of protrusive parts (14) able to catch the protrusive strip part (24) of the neck part (2). The protrusive parts (14) catch and separate the band (12) for opening when the cap main body (10) is being removed. The protrusive strip (24) of the part (2) is formed with a slit in a width for the part (14) of the band (12) to go through. <P>COPYRIGHT: (C)2004,JPO

In the above-mentioned container, a fixing ring (annular sealing band) is connected to a lower portion of a cap (lid body) via a breakable connecting portion (fragile portion), and the fixing ring is provided below the mouth and neck. There is a locking protrusion that hooks on the reverse rotation prevention protrusion.When the cap is rotated when opening, the locking ring rotates by the so-called ratchet mechanism between the locking protrusion on the fixing ring and the reverse rotation prevention protrusion on the mouth and neck. Is regulated, the connecting portion is broken, and only the cap body is rotated to come off. In addition, a slip-out prevention step (recess) is formed on the lower end edge of the reversing prevention protrusion of the mouth and neck, and an inward protrusion is provided on the lower end of the fixing ring, and the cap body is removed from the mouth and neck. In this case, the fixing ring remains at the base of the mouth / neck portion (below the reverse rotation preventing projection) due to the engagement between the inward protrusion of the fixing ring and the slip-out preventing step portion of the mouth / neck portion.

By the way, in recent years, when a container is discarded, it is desired to separate the container body and the lid from the viewpoint of recycling and the like. However, in the above-described lid structure adopted in the conventional container, there is a problem that the sealing band, which is a part of the lid remaining on the container body side after opening, is difficult to remove and is difficult to separate.

In the above lid structure, when the lid main body is detached, the protrusion of the sealing strip is caught by the ridge on the base of the mouth and neck, and the movement of the sealing strip in the detaching direction of the lid main body is restricted. Therefore, the fragile portion connecting the lid main body and the sealing strip is broken, only the lid main body is removed, and the sealing strip remains at the base of the mouth and neck. Further, when the container body is tilted and used, the protruding portion of the remaining sealing strip is hooked on the protruding portion of the mouth and neck portion. At that time, since the slits of the ridges of the mouth and neck are formed in an arrangement pattern different from that of the protrusions, the sealing band does not fall off from the mouth and neck. Then, when removing the sealing strip from the mouth and neck, by rotating the sealing strip while lifting it toward the upper end of the mouth and neck, the protrusion of the sealing strip can be passed through the slit of the ridge of the mouth and neck. , The sealing strip can be moved to the upper side of the ridge and removed.
